Storing TikTok Chicken Cobbler

  • Refrigerate leftovers in an airtight container within 2 hours of cooking to maintain freshness and prevent bacterial growth.
  • Store cooled chicken cobbler in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days, ensuring it's covered tightly with plastic wrap or a lid.
  • Freeze individual portions in freezer-safe containers for up to 2 months, which helps preserve the dish's texture and flavor.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Protein:

  • 2 cups cooked, shredded chicken

Baking and Soup Base:

  • 1 packet Red Lobster Cheddar Bay Biscuit Mix
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1/2 cup (118 milliliters) butter, melted
  • 1 can (10.5 ounces / 298 grams) cream of chicken soup
  • 2 cups (473 milliliters) chicken broth

Seasonings and Vegetables:

  • 1 cup frozen mixed vegetables
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  1. Heat the oven to 375F (190C) and prepare a 9×13-inch baking dish with cooking spray.
  2. Create an even layer of shredded chicken across the bottom of the dish, then distribute frozen mixed vegetables uniformly.
  3. Combine cream of chicken soup with chicken broth in a mixing bowl, whisking until smooth. Carefully pour the liquid mixture over the chicken and vegetables.
  4. In another bowl, blend Cheddar Bay Biscuit Mix with milk and selected seasonings until just combined. Gently spread the biscuit mixture across the top of the chicken layer, avoiding stirring to maintain distinct layers.
  5. Drizzle melted butter evenly over the entire surface of the biscuit topping.
  6. Transfer the dish to the preheated oven and bake for 40-45 minutes, watching for a golden-brown crust and bubbling edges that indicate the cobbler is fully cooked.
  7. Remove from the oven and allow the cobbler to rest for 5-10 minutes, which helps the filling set and makes serving easier. Scoop and serve warm.

Notes

  • Shred chicken in advance and store in freezer bags for quick assembly, saving precious time during busy weeknights.
  • Swap frozen mixed vegetables with fresh seasonal vegetables like bell peppers, zucchini, or fresh green beans for extra nutrition and vibrant color.
  • For gluten-free version, use gluten-free cream of chicken soup and a gluten-free biscuit mix to accommodate dietary restrictions without compromising flavor.
  • Enhance the dish’s depth by adding herbs like thyme, rosemary, or parsley to the chicken mixture for an aromatic and more complex taste profile.
